Alex Rae

 

Club: Special Olympics Grampian
Sport: Table Tennis
Hometown: Aberdeen

For more than 20 years, Alex has proudly represented Special Olympics GB while building a successful career with Co-op.

Having first picked up a table tennis bat at the age of nine, Alex has spent more than two decades competing with Special Olympics GB, earning selection for the 2023 World Summer Games in Berlin, where he won two silver medals.

Alongside his sporting success, he's built a 25-year career with Co-op in Aberdeen – where he is a trusted and respected colleague who plays an active role in his local store and wider Aberdeen community.

His story shows how the confidence, determination and friendships built through sport can create opportunities far beyond competition, helping change perceptions both on and off the field of play.

Sharing how Special Olympics GB has shaped his journey, Alex Rae said: “Representing my country and winning two medals in Berlin was such a surreal moment. Since then, I have been finding my voice more and more. Coaching now gives me the opportunity to help other young people build confidence, believe in themselves and reach their potential, just as my coach George did for me.”
